MENNO BOYS, GIRLS 3RD AT HOME RELAYS

The Menno High School boys and girls both finished third among 14 varsity teams competing at the Menno Relays held at the Jon Woehl Athletic Complex Thursday, April 15. The boys finished with 67 points; Beresford was second with 81 and Hanson won the division with 131.5 points. The girls finished with 92.5 points; Beresford was second with 96 and Colman-Egan claimed the top spot with 98.5 points.

The Freeman Academy/Marion boys finished in a tie for fourth while Freeman Public was ninth.

The Freeman Public girls placed eighth while Freeman Academy/Marion was 10th.

In the junior high boys division, Menno was fifth, FA/Marion was sixth and Freeman Public was 10th in the 12-team field.

For the junior high girls, Freeman Public was second, Menno was 10th and FA/Marion was 11th.
